Sea Port brand Recalled by Sea Port Products Corp Due to Shrimp may be contaminated with Cesium-137 (Cs-137).

Date: September 22, 2025
Company: Sea Port Products Corp
Status: Terminated
Source: FDA (Food)

Affected Products

Sea Port brand, Raw Frozen Easy Peel Headless Shell-On White Shrimp, Jumbo size 16-20. Product of Indonesia. Distributed by Sea Port Products Corporation, Kirkland, WA. Master Case: 10/2 lbs. bags. Net weight 20lbs. UPC 10659878008617 IQF Inner Bag 2lbs: UPC 6 59878 00861 0 Sea Port brand, Raw Frozen Easy Peel Headless Shell-On White Shrimp, Jumbo size 16-20. Product of Indonesia. Distributed by Sea Port Products Corporation, Kirkland, WA. Master Case: 20/1 lbs. bags. Net weight 20 lbs. UPC 10659878010016 IQF Inner Bag 1lbs: UPC 6 59878 01001 9

Quantity: 1,260 cases (10/2lbs. packs per case) and 540 cases (20/1lbs. packs per case)

Why Was This Recalled?

Shrimp may be contaminated with Cesium-137 (Cs-137).

Where Was This Sold?

This product was distributed to 5 states: CA, HI, MT, OR, WA
